## Releases

Chatterbin is, as the name suggests, extremely chatty. From release 1.6 onward, logs are sampled at 1-in-50 for INFO and unsampled for WARN and above; adjust via the sampler config, not code. Release tarballs are built by the Ferncroft pipeline and signed automatically. Verify downloads using the key below.

release key, fajef-kajeg: bky19_LdLu6Ne6FLi8he2c24d

/*
 * SQL_LINT_RULESET pins which Groverly lint rules run on .sql files
 * in CI. Yes, the uppercase-keywords rule is mandatory — fight me in
 * review, not in the config. Adding a rule here? Bump the ruleset
 * version too, or caching gets weird. Rules were last validated
 * against the following build.
 */

session token of tajef-bageg = htk21_5d90d574934f3ccae6437

## Build Provenance: Cron Migration to Loomflow

All scheduled jobs formerly on cron hosts now run in the Loomflow workflow engine. Plugin authors should declare schedules in the manifest; host crontabs are ignored as of this release. Provenance attestations are generated per run. The migration build is identified by the token below.

session token of fahap-hawip = htk31_7852f2b3276dba2738f98fa97f92237

## Authentication

Welcome to Thankstamp, our donation-receipt mailer. Before you can send anything (even to the sandbox inbox), you need to authenticate against Mailforge, the internal delivery service that actually pushes the receipts out.

The flow is simple: Thankstamp signs each batch request with a service key, Mailforge checks it, and receipts go out. If you see `auth_rejected` in the logs, nine times out of ten it's a missing or stale key in your local env file. For local development, use the sandbox key below.

API key for yahig-tadup: kto7_ubizbYm

Handover for the Meridly calendar sync issue: duplicate events appear when two devices push conflicting edits within the debounce window. I've narrowed it to the merge resolver preferring local timestamps. Priya's patch is staged but not deployed. Don't ship 4.2 until the resolver flags below are verified. These are the current production values for the sync service.

deployment values, kajep-kageg:
[praix]
host = praix.paliqcorp.corp
user = praix_svc
database = praix_prod